The import code lens action (hover over non-explicit imports and trigger a code lens action) and the import code action (hover over an unimported identifier and trigger a code action) differ in some ways:

0. the code action imports things with explicit constructors (e.g. `Either(Left, Right)` instead of `Either(..)`)
1. the code action **fails** to distinguish between a constructor and a type, (e.g. if I want to import `Data.Either.Left` it will generate `import Data.Either (Left)`, which is not valid)

I feel that both for consistency, and as an improvement to the code action (point 0. is subjective, but point 1. is definitely a bug), it would be nice if these two could be unified, to the behaviour of the code lens.

Is there some technical reason to be unable to do so, e.g. "before we have the imports we haven't loaded necessary data and are therefore unable to determine whether `Left` should be a constructor or a type"?

I am also willing to do work on this, if someone is willing to provide guidance.
